基于“風(fēng)壓脈沖”的大跨屋蓋結(jié)構(gòu)極值風(fēng)壓估計方法研究
陳龍1,王叢菲1,武岳1,2,劉海峰1
摘 要

(1 哈爾濱工業(yè)大學(xué)建筑設(shè)計研究院, 哈爾濱 150090; 2 哈爾濱工業(yè)大學(xué)土木工程學(xué)院, 哈爾濱 150090)

[摘要]通過少量樣本實現(xiàn)結(jié)構(gòu)極值風(fēng)壓的概率估計一直是結(jié)構(gòu)風(fēng)工程領(lǐng)域的研究熱點。對此,借鑒改進“獨立風(fēng)暴”法,發(fā)展了基于“風(fēng)壓脈沖”的極值風(fēng)壓估計方法,然后結(jié)合平面屋蓋和球面屋蓋的多次采樣風(fēng)洞試驗,對基于“風(fēng)壓脈沖”的極值風(fēng)壓估計方法與改進“獨立風(fēng)暴”法進行比較。結(jié)果表明,基于“風(fēng)壓脈沖”的極值風(fēng)壓估計方法通過較小容量樣本即可建立起相對精確的目標(biāo)概率模型,獲得較為準(zhǔn)確的極值估計結(jié)果。將基于“風(fēng)壓脈沖”的極值風(fēng)壓估計方法應(yīng)用于實際工程大跨屋蓋結(jié)構(gòu)的極值風(fēng)壓估計中,驗證了此方法的可行性和有效性。

[關(guān)鍵詞]極值風(fēng)壓; 風(fēng)壓脈沖; 改進“獨立風(fēng)暴”法; 小容量樣本; 風(fēng)洞試驗

Method for estimating extreme wind pressure on large-span roof structure based on“wind pressure pulse events”

Chen Long1, Wang Congfei1, Wu Yue1,2, Liu Haifeng1

(1 The Architectural Design and Research Institute of HIT, Harbin 150090, China; 2 School of Civil Engineering, Harbin Institute of Technology, Harbin 150090, China)

Abstract:Probability assessment of extreme wind pressure on structure with small sample size has been one of hot research issues in structural wind engineering. Based on“Modified Independent Storms Method”, an estimate method on extreme wind pressure pulse was proposed. Then, combined with the multiple sampling wind tunnel tests of the flat roof and the spherical roof, the extreme wind pressure estimation method based on“wind pressure pulse”was compared with the improved“Modified Independent Storms Method”. The results show that extreme wind pressure estimation method based on“wind pressure pulse”can establish a relatively accurate target probability model with small sample size and obtain a more accurate extreme value estimation result. The extreme wind pressure estimation method based on“wind pressure pulse”was applied to estimation of the extreme wind pressure of the large-span roof structure of a real engineering, and the feasibility and effectiveness of this method were verified.

Keywords:extreme wind pressure; wind pressure pulse; Modified Independent Storms Method; small sample size;  wind tunnel test
